Brain


Definition:

  • (n.) The whitish mass of soft matter (the center of the nervous system, and the seat of consciousness and volition) which is inclosed in the cartilaginous or bony cranium of vertebrate animals. It is simply the anterior termination of the spinal cord, and is developed from three embryonic vesicles, whose cavities are connected with the central canal of the cord; the cavities of the vesicles become the central cavities, or ventricles, and the walls thicken unequally and become the three segments, the fore-, mid-, and hind-brain.
  • (n.) The anterior or cephalic ganglion in insects and other invertebrates.
  • (n.) The organ or seat of intellect; hence, the understanding.
  • (n.) The affections; fancy; imagination.
  • (v. t.) To dash out the brains of; to kill by beating out the brains. Hence, Fig.: To destroy; to put an end to; to defeat.
  • (v. t.) To conceive; to understand.

Memory


Definition:

  • (n.) The faculty of the mind by which it retains the knowledge of previous thoughts, impressions, or events.
  • (n.) The reach and positiveness with which a person can remember; the strength and trustworthiness of one's power to reach and represent or to recall the past; as, his memory was never wrong.
  • (n.) The actual and distinct retention and recognition of past ideas in the mind; remembrance; as, in memory of youth; memories of foreign lands.
  • (n.) The time within which past events can be or are remembered; as, within the memory of man.
  • (n.) Something, or an aggregate of things, remembered; hence, character, conduct, etc., as preserved in remembrance, history, or tradition; posthumous fame; as, the war became only a memory.
  • (n.) A memorial.
